If you are a patient aged 16 years or over and registered at a Coventry and Warwickshire GP Practice, you can be referred by your GP. Patients cannot self-refer into the service.
A consultant dermatologist assesses all referrals to Primary Care Dermatology, and treatment is provided by GPs with additional training and experience in dermatology.

Will I get the specialist care I need?
Yes. Referrals are initially reviewed by a consultant dermatologist to assess whether they are suitable for our service. If not, the patient will be passed onto secondary care.
GPs delivering Primary Care Dermatology have undergone additional training to take on this role, including clinical experience of delivering dermatology services.
How quickly will I be seen?
Although we can’t give an exact timeframe, we aim to see you within six weeks. The waiting times for the primary care service are likely to be much shorter than being referred to hospital.
Will I see my normal GP?
This is a consultant-led service and initially all referrals will be assessed for suitability by a dermatology consultant. Once accepted into our service, you will be seen by a GP with additional training and expertise in dermatology, and treatment will be provided in dedicated clinic sessions (even if based at your normal practice).
The outcomes of your visit to our clinic will be included in the clinical notes at your GP practice, with your consent, so your GP will know what treatment you have received and any ongoing care that may be required once you have been discharged from our service.
Who will be providing the service?
Primary Care Dermatology is run by Coventry & Warwickshire Integrated Primary Care which is made up of the GP Federations which represent local GP practices across the region. We are also working with Consultant Connect who provide the consultant dermatologists and secondary care oversight.
This means patients are initially assessed by a specialist dermatology consultant and then seen in clinics by specially trained GPs with extra training in dermatology.
By working together in this way, we can provide more services to patients within local communities.
Will providing this service impact the general availability of GP appointments?
No. Although many of the clinicians running this service will be from local practices, any time dedicated to this service will be outside of their existing GP commitments. Running this service will not lead to a reduction in the amount of GP appointments at your local practice.
